In the heart of Khmelnytskyi, located in the picturesque country of Ukraine, lies an iconic memorial complex — the Eternal Flame. This place, steeped in history and deep respect for the past, is the centerpiece of the memorial park. The complex is a solemn composition dedicated to the memory of the city's defenders, where the flame, burning day and night, serves as a symbol of unfading glory and the resilience of the human spirit.

The memorial harmoniously combines the functions of a historical monument and a cozy urban space. The central area is surrounded by commemorative plaques, while the surrounding grounds are landscaped with shady alleys and well-tended flowerbeds. This makes the site not only an essential stop for those interested in historical heritage, but also a place for quiet walks and reflection away from the city's hustle and bustle.

Thanks to its location in Pioneer Square (often called Eternal Flame Square), the attraction is popular with both locals and tourists. The site's high rating confirms its significance: visitors note the special solemn atmosphere and the aesthetic clarity of the architectural ensemble, which remains one of Khmelnytskyi's most recognizable locations.

Getting There

Reaching this memorial site in Khmelnytskyi is easy thanks to its central location. The memorial is situated in a square popular with locals on Proskurivska Street. If you are in the city's main square, a leisurely walk to the memorial will only take about 10–15 minutes.

Visitors can take advantage of a well-developed public transport network: the nearest trolleybus, bus, and minibus stops are located within a few minutes' walk of the square. It is also convenient to take a taxi from anywhere in the city; simply provide the address — 64/24 Proskurivska Street.

For those who prefer to travel by private car, parking spaces are available around the square. Cyclists and pedestrians will also appreciate the ease of access thanks to well-maintained sidewalks and pedestrian zones in this part of Khmelnytskyi.

History & Facts

The history of the memorial complex began in the post-war years, when the decision was made to create a place of strength and memory in Khmelnytskyi. The opening of the site in Pioneer Square was a significant event for the city, commemorating the feat of the liberating soldiers. During that period, such monuments were erected as symbols of resilience and the undying gratitude of future generations.

The symbol of the Eternal Flame itself has deep roots and is associated in many cultures with eternal memory and the enduring spirit of heroes. In Khmelnytskyi, this fire burns continuously, embodying the idea of generational continuity and respect for the region's historical past.

Over time, the area surrounding the memorial has transformed: the square has become an important public space. Today, it is not just a historical site, but a hub of cultural and collective memory, where city residents gather on significant dates to honor traditions and remember important chapters in their region's history.

Working Hours

The memorial is open to visitors 24 hours a day, daily. You can come here early in the morning for solitary reflection or late in the evening to see the flame in the quiet of the night. Admission to the complex is free and does not require tickets.

Since the site is located outdoors in a public square, there are no specific operating breaks. However, to get up-to-date information on possible events or temporary changes in access to the square, visitors are encouraged to follow news on official city resources.
